  • Ethanoic Acid & Sodium Hydroxide Reaction: Balanced Equation & Explanation
    The balanced equation for the reaction of ethanoic acid (CH₃COOH) and sodium hydroxide (NaOH) is:

    CH₃COOH (aq) + NaOH (aq) → CH₃COONa (aq) + H₂O (l)

    Here's what the equation represents:

    * CH₃COOH (aq): Ethanoic acid in aqueous solution (acetic acid)

    * NaOH (aq): Sodium hydroxide in aqueous solution

    * CH₃COONa (aq): Sodium ethanoate (sodium acetate) in aqueous solution

    * H₂O (l): Water in liquid form

    Explanation:

    This is a neutralization reaction where an acid (ethanoic acid) reacts with a base (sodium hydroxide) to form a salt (sodium ethanoate) and water. The hydrogen ion (H+) from the acid combines with the hydroxide ion (OH-) from the base to form water.
